Chemical Composition & Physical Properties

DURON’s Adamite Rolls (ASB Rolls) offer an optimal combination of structural toughness and wear resistance. Through controlled additions of Chromium, Nickel, and Molybdenum, we tailor the carbide distribution within the pearlitic matrix to ensure consistent material density. By precise balancing of the carbon equivalent, these specialized adamite rolls exhibit reliable resistance to thermal cracking and mechanical fatigue in heavy breakdown stands. The chemical compositions and metallurgical specifications for these adamite rolls are detailed below:

Code (代码) C Si Mn Cr Ni Mo Barrel Hardness (HSD)
AD1401 1.30-1.50 0.30-0.60 0.70-1.10 0.80-1.20 0.50-1.20 0.20-0.60 35-50
AD1601 1.50-1.70 0.30-0.60 0.80-1.30 0.80-2.00 ≥ 0.20 0.20-0.60 40-60
AD180 1.70-1.90 0.30-0.80 0.60-1.10 0.80-1.50 0.50-2.00 0.20-0.60 45-60

* Neck Hardness limits: AD1401 ≤ 45 HSD; AD1601/AD180 ≤ 50 HSD.
* P ≤ 0.035, S ≤ 0.030 for all AD series grades.

Metallurgical Excellence

Why Choose DURON Adamite Rolls for Heavy Reduction Stands?

  • Balanced Carbon-Alloy Matrix : With carbon levels strictly controlled between 1.30% and 1.90%, the microstructure avoids the extreme brittleness of high-carbon iron while achieving higher wear resistance than standard cast steel. This makes it an effective compromise for varied roughing tasks.

  • Controlled Carbide Distribution : The specific ratio of Chromium, Nickel, and Molybdenum promotes a uniform distribution of fine carbides. This structural feature aids in maintaining consistent friction and reducing pass deterioration during heavy section rolling.

  • Reliable Operational Yield: By offering improved thermal crazing resistance compared to cast steel and better impact resistance compared to cast iron, the Adamite series supports continuous mill operation and predictable maintenance cycles.

Manufacturing Control & Inspection

100% Non-Destructive Testing

Every roll undergoes rigorous Ultrasonic Testing (UT) at the working layer and bonding zone to eliminate internal voids and ensure structural integrity under heavy loads.

Precision CNC Machining

Roll necks and barrel profiles are machined using heavy-duty CNC equipment, strictly adhering to your drawing's dimensional and runout tolerances for perfect bearing fitment.

Metallurgical Verification

Chemical compositions are analyzed via spectrometer pre-pouring, and multi-point hardness mapping is conducted post-heat treatment to guarantee the specified hardness gradient.

Quality Traceability

All dispatched rolls are accompanied by a comprehensive inspection certificate, documenting chemical composition, hardness distribution, and UT reports.
